Format(Число_или_переменная, формат)
Oxygen писал(а):Это не Апи. В МСДН есть точно. Используется так, если упрощенно:Формат "#####" количество # - это количество символов, сколько тебе нужно отобразить. Можно использовать точку и запятые.
- Код: Выделить всё
Format(Число_или_переменная, формат)
Caption это не совсем то. Это надпись на кнопке. Насколько я помню.
Private Function CheckValues(str_Val As String) As String
If str_Val <> "" Then
If Len(str_Val) < 2 Then
If (Val(Right$(str_Val, 1)) > 0 Or Right$(str_Val, 1) = "0") Then
CheckValues = str_Val
Else: CheckValues = Left$(str_Val, Len(str_Val) - 1)
End If
Else
tmp_str$ = ""
For I = 1 To Len(str_Val)
If (Val(Mid$(str_Val, I, 1)) > 0 Or Mid$(str_Val, I, 1) = "0") Then tmp_str$ = tmp_str$ + Mid$(str_Val, I, 1)
Next I
CheckValues = tmp_str$
End If
End If
End Function
переводи фокус на какой-то определенный объект и лови событие у этого объекта
Valenok писал(а):Понятно.
А можно как то ограничить ввод тоесть так чтобы вводились только цифры а не вводится всё что угодно а если не цифра то не добавляем её..
Private Sub Text1_Change()
If Not IsNumeric(Text1.Text) Then
MsgBox "Только цифры"
End If
End Sub
или в такую запись:
9.88765132684 * 10^29
Хакер писал(а):И ещё. Подобную проверку надо делать в _Validate, а не в _Change.
Если много текст боксов, то после куча предупреждений вылезет, и думай куда не правильно ввел.
Хакер писал(а):Начал удалять число "12q3456" с конца Backspace-ом и каждый раз получаешь предупреждение.
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 54